Well, I've just purchased a Dahon Curve and am quite satisfied with my decision. =D I visited some stores and test rode a few folders and I must say I was very impressed with them in general. My favourite was probably the Brompton - it's just such a comfortable ride in such a neat little package. Unfortunately, you guys were very right about me underestimating the bulk and weight of the average folder. =D The only one I could easily lift was the Curve, however I really liked the way the Brompton could be rolled when folded - it's somewhat awkward to roll the folded Curve.
I was very tempted to purchase the Brompton, however I couldn't convince myself it was worth more than three times the price of the cute little Dahon. I find the Curve more difficult to power and it's certainly a twitchy little thing, but it's light and, while not very comfortable, not exactly a pain to ride either.
